Bedroom firefighting
Hi, I’m Nathan, the inventor of the Dreamfox cooling sleep mask. For years, I struggled with restless sleep when summer came around. I’d wake up overheating in the middle of the night, kicking off covers, sweating, never quite getting the deep sleep I needed. I’d start my work as a firefighter already feeling drained instead of ready to go. In the fire service, we’re trained to understand heat, how it’s transferred through conduction, convection, and radiation, and how to manage it in extreme conditions. We use cooling strategies like hydration, venting heat, and water cooling methods to stay effective. I thought to myself, I know so much about staying cool at work, surely I can find a way to do it at night?

On my days off, I researched body temperature and sleep and tested cooling sleep masks on the market. Most relied on gel packs or beads, they felt cool at first but absorbed body heat quickly, warming and becoming uncomfortable within 10 to 30 minutes. The cooling never lasted through the night. Using what I knew about managing heat, I began making and testing my own prototypes at home. Studies suggest up to one in three people struggle with sleeping hot, yet nothing truly solved the problem. After months of refining, I came up with the dream fox mask, which uses evaporation of water to remove heat throughout the night. I hope that if you suffer from the same restless nights as I did, it can help you too.
